Notes of smoked meat lend a savory, meaty depth to the black cherry and blackcurrant flavors in this robust Syrah. Aging in both barrels and tanks balances the rich black fruit with lively acidity and chalky, lingering tannins. Somewhere between supple, smooth, and full-bodied, the 4 Vents cuvée is an exceptional and elegant example of Crozes.

About the estate:
Lucie and Nacy Fourel withdrew their vineyards from the cooperative winery in 2010, the year of their first vintage. Today, their 10 hectares are vinified using native yeasts and without SO2, with more convincing results in their reds than in their whites.
